概述命名管道是一種進程間通信,IPC,機制,它允許在同一計算機上運行的不同進程之間交換數據,ConnectNamedPipe函數用于在客戶端進程和服務器進程之間建立命名管道連接,函數原型BOOLConnectNamedPipe,[in]HANDLEhNamedPipe,[in]LPOVERLAPPEDlpOverlapped,參數h...。
最新資訊 2024-09-16 09:30:29
ConnectNamedPipe函數用于連接到命名管道,在使用此函數時,需要了解一些潛在的陷阱和故障排除技巧,以確保管道連接的可靠性和高效性,陷阱1.權限不足,如果調用方沒有足夠的權限訪問管道,ConnectNamedPipe將失敗,確保調用方具有創建、讀取或寫入管道的權限,具體取決于預期的操作,2.管道不存在,如果尚未創建管道,或在...。
最新資訊 2024-09-16 09:28:10
簡介在進程之間安全地交換數據至關重要,尤其是在分布式系統或應用程序需要跨越進程邊界通信時,命名管道提供了一種有效且通用的機制來實現進程間通信,IPC,,同時保持數據安全和完整性,使用ConnectNamedPipeConnectNamedPipe是一個WindowsAPI函數,用于在兩個進程之間建立命名管道連接,它使用服務器和客戶端模...。
技術教程 2024-09-16 09:26:29
命名管道是一種半雙工的通信機制,允許不同進程之間進行數據交換,它是一種基于文件的通信方式,因此使用起來非常方便,在不同的編程語言中,建立命名管道連接的方法有所不同,本文將介紹在C,C,、Python和Java語言中如何使用ConnectNamedPipe函數建立命名管道連接,C,C,```c,includeintmain,...。
技術教程 2024-09-16 09:24:20
本指南將介紹ConnectNamedPipe函數的高級用法,重點關注建立異步連接和處理錯誤的情況,ConnectNamedPipe函數用于在Windows操作系統中創建和連接到命名管道,異步連接在某些情況下,您可能希望異步建立管道連接,這在處理大量連接或需要最大化吞吐量時很有用,要異步建立連接,請使用OVERLAPPED結構,OVER...。
互聯網資訊 2024-09-16 09:22:42
概述命名管道是一種用于進程間通信,IPC,的機制,它允許不同進程在同一臺計算機上可靠地交換數據,命名管道類似于管道,但它們提供了更高級別的功能,例如命名命名空間和安全機制,ConnectNamedPipe函數用于連接到現有的命名管道,它是一個WindowsAPI函數,可以在C和C,程序中使用,語法c,BOOLConnectName...。
本站公告 2024-09-16 09:20:49
概述命名管道是一種用于在不同進程之間進行進程間通信,IPC,的Windows機制,ConnectNamedPipe函數用于建立與命名管道的連接,本文檔將介紹使用ConnectNamedPipe函數建立命名管道連接的最佳實踐,重點關注使用cookie實現用戶登錄,最佳實踐1.使用命名管道服務器創建命名管道服務器以偵聽客戶端連接請求,服務...。
最新資訊 2024-09-16 09:19:30
簡介命名管道是一種進程間通信,IPC,機制,允許在同一計算機或網絡上的計算機之間進行通信,它提供了一種客戶端和服務器之間單向或雙向通信的機制,要與命名管道服務器建立連接,客戶端需要調用ConnectNamedPipe函數,該函數需要管道名稱和一些標記作為參數,這些標記指定連接模式和訪問權限,參數ConnectNamedPipe函數具有...。
本站公告 2024-09-16 09:18:00
命名管道是一種特殊的IPC機制,允許在進程之間進行通信,可以使用ConnectNamedPipe函數建立與命名管道服務器的連接,語法BOOLConnectNamedPipe,[in]HANDLEhNamedPipe,[in]LPDWORDlpWaitTime,參數,參數,說明,hNamedPipe,管道服務器的句...。
本站公告 2024-09-16 09:16:55